10142 West 119th Street, Overland Park, KS 66213
Enjoy authentic Indian & Pakistani cuisine by Master Chef Zubair Shah daily lunch buffets, weekend dinner buffets and Sunday brunch buffet. Kababesh Grill serves a bountiful array of aromatic, fresh dishes. Vegetarian selections are always available. All Food & Beverages are 100% Zabiha Halal. The owners of this restaurant are Muslim and have confirmed its halal status. All buffet and menu items are certified Zabihah halal.
